Furnas Caldera and Fumaroles: A Living Volcano Explained
What are the Furnas fumaroles and why is the ground so hot?
Furnas sits inside an active volcanic caldera, so rainwater seeping down meets rock heated by shallow magma and returns to the surface as steam vents, boiling springs and bubbling mud. The heat is genuine and can scald, which is why the marked paths and fenced viewing areas around the village and Lagoa das Furnas exist and should never be left.

Reading a Caldera: What You’re Actually Standing In
A caldera is not a crater left by a single blast. It forms when a volcano’s magma chamber partly empties during an eruption and the ground above collapses into the space left behind, leaving a wide depression rather than a peak. Furnas’ caldera is several kilometres across, and the village, the Lagoa das Furnas, the surrounding hills and the geothermal field all sit inside that collapsed basin.
The volcano has erupted within recorded history — most recently in 1630, an explosive event that reshaped part of the caldera floor. Since then, activity has stayed geothermal rather than eruptive: no lava, no ash, but a steady, visible release of heat through steam vents, hot springs and gas seeps. That is the difference worth holding onto for the rest of this page — Furnas today is quiet in the sense that matters for safety, but it is not dormant in the sense that matters for understanding it.

Where the Ground Steams: The Village Fumaroles
Furnas’ most accessible geothermal field sits at the northern edge of the village, a short walk from the centre and well signposted. Here, clustered vents send up steam continuously, mud pools bubble in slow, thick pulses, and the smell of sulphur is unmistakable well before you reach the fenced viewing area. Paths and boardwalks run around and between the vents, close enough to feel the heat on your skin and hear the water moving underground, but kept back from the ground that is actually dangerous.
This is the field most visitors picture when they think of Furnas, and it rewards slow walking rather than a quick photo stop — the vents vary in temperature, colour and behaviour from one metre to the next, and the ground itself changes underfoot from ordinary soil to bare, mineral-stained rock in the space of a few steps. Lagoa das Furnas: Boiling Water at the Lake’s Edge
A second, quieter geothermal field lies along the southern shore of Lagoa das Furnas, a short drive or a longer walk from the village centre. This is where the caldera’s heat meets the lake directly: steam vents rise a few metres from the waterline, and several roadside pools reach temperatures close to boiling. It is also where the village’s cozido pots go into the ground each morning — not as a separate attraction laid on for visitors, but because this specific patch of shoreline has reliably usable heat close to the surface, and has done for generations.
The pots themselves cook for five to seven hours on that heat alone, with no fire lit anywhere near them, and are lifted out around midday by the restaurant staff who buried them. Away from the cooking pits, the lakeside vents are open to view from a short path and a car park, and this is usually the quieter of Furnas’ two geothermal stops, since most day-trip itineraries spend longer at the village field and the Terra Nostra gardens. The pools here are not for bathing — this is a different kind of thermal water from the swimmable pools at Poça da Dona Beija, which sit on a separate, cooler spring elsewhere in the caldera.
Why the Marked Paths Are Not a Suggestion
The single fact worth carrying out of Furnas is that the ground can be genuinely dangerous a very short distance from where it looks completely ordinary. Surface pools around the fumarole fields regularly sit close to boiling point, and the crust between a visible vent and hidden, superheated ground beneath it can be thin enough to break underfoot. There is no visual cue reliable enough to judge this by eye — solid-looking earth a metre from a marked path can be no safer than the vent itself.
That is why every geothermal area in Furnas is fenced, boardwalked or otherwise marked, and why stepping past a barrier for a closer look, a better photograph or a shortcut is never worth it. This applies at the village field, at the lakeside vents, and anywhere else steam is visible along the caldera floor — the paths exist because people have been badly burned by ignoring them, not as an overcautious formality. Weather adds a second layer worth planning around. Furnas sits low in its caldera and clouds settle over it more often than over the coast, so the fumarole fields can be damp, humid and low-visibility even on a clear day at Ponta Delgada. None of that changes the ground’s temperature, only how far you can see it — reason enough to keep to the paths even when the steam itself is the only thing visible ahead.

Furnas in the Wider Volcanic Story of São Miguel
Furnas is one of three central volcanoes that, together with a long fissure zone running through the middle of the island, built São Miguel over the last several hundred thousand years. Sete Cidades and Lagoa do Fogo are the other two, and all three remain classified as active — meaning monitored, not meaning imminent. The Azores sit on the boundary of three tectonic plates, and geothermal activity of exactly this kind — steam, hot springs, warm ground — shows up across several of the nine islands, though Furnas is the clearest and most walkable example anywhere in the archipelago.
That context matters for how to read what you’re seeing at the vents. The steam rising from the ground in Furnas is not a leftover from an eruption centuries ago; it is a continuous process, driven by rainwater cycling down to hot rock and back up again, that has been running for as long as the caldera has existed and will keep running long after any visit ends. Nothing about it needs an eruption to explain it, and nothing about it should be mistaken for the volcano being dormant.
Planning a Visit to the Furnas Fumaroles
Both geothermal fields — the village vents and the lakeside pools — are free to visit and open year-round, with no ticket office and no fixed hours, though early morning and late afternoon tend to be quieter than the middle of the day. Good, closed footwear matters more here than almost anywhere else on the island; the ground around the vents is uneven, sometimes wet with condensation, and not a place for sandals. A jacket is worth carrying even in summer, since the caldera sits higher and damper than the coast and cloud can settle in with little warning.
Furnas combines naturally with a night or two based in or near the village, given how much sits within walking distance — the fumaroles, Terra Nostra, and the lake itself. For visitors basing themselves elsewhere on the island, it also works well as a single long day trip from Ponta Delgada or from the south coast, roughly forty minutes to an hour’s drive depending on the route taken. Furnas Caldera and Fumaroles: Common Questions
Is Furnas an active volcano?
Yes. Furnas is one of three active central volcanoes on São Miguel, and its caldera has erupted within recorded history, most recently in 1630. The current activity is geothermal rather than eruptive: steam, hot springs and gas rather than lava.
Is it safe to walk near the fumaroles?
It is safe on the marked paths and boardwalks, which keep visitors back from vents where the ground can exceed boiling point just beneath the crust. It is not safe to step past a fence or barrier for a closer look or a photo, however solid the ground appears.
Does the water in Lagoa das Furnas actually boil?
At several points along the lake’s southern shore, yes. Steam vents and bubbling pools sit right at the waterline, and some of the shoreline pools reach close to boiling point. It is this same heat that cooks the village’s cozido pots underground nearby.
Can you smell the fumaroles from the village?
Yes, sulphur is noticeable through much of central Furnas, strongest near the vent clusters at the northern edge of the village and along the lake’s edge. It fades away from the geothermal fields, which sit within walking distance of the centre.
How hot does the ground get around Furnas?
Surface pools regularly sit at 90 to nearly 100 degrees Celsius, and the ground itself can be far hotter a short distance down. There is no way to judge this by sight, which is the core reason to stay on the paths.
Is Furnas the same as the cozido meal?
No. Furnas is the caldera and village; cozido das Furnas is one specific dish cooked in its geothermal heat. The dish depends on the ground here, but the geology and the meal are two separate things to plan for.
